99 tercel starter burnt out

Hi,All:

A red warning light started to flash after I drove about 50 miles on the highway. I found the light means the parking brake was not released(But everything was fine in the first 50 miles).Then the car decelerated in a sudden. The engine or the fan was still running after I pulled the key out of the car. The dealer told me they can not diagnose this car unless they put a new starter in it. I was told the starter was burnt out. Does anyone know what might caused the starter burnt out? I am afraid that the car maybe has some other problems except the starter.
